Payment is expected when services are rendered. In order to focus on our patients' needs, customer service, and minimizing costs, we do not bill or have payment plans. We take ALL methods of payment, including all major credit cards, checks, cash, pet insurance, and now CareCredit. All cards must be signed by the owner of the card.
The highly trained veterinarians and staff at Animal Care Center of Pahrump are available to treat pets who are suffering from life-threatening trauma and disease. Our clinic is available for transfers from your primary care veterinarian, as well as for walk-in urgent care needs and emergencies.
We are equipped with continuous cardiac telemetry, pulse oximetry, blood pressure, in-house laboratory, digital radiographs (X-rays), emergency surgery procedures, and ultrasound.For pets that need oxygen supplementation, we have ICU units that provide an oxygen-enriched and humidity controlled environment.
